How much do packaging associ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for packaging associate in Oregon is $17.92,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.24 and $18.80 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Packaging Associates?

Packaging Associates are workers responsible for preparing products for shipment by packaging them according to company standards. Their tasks typically include assembling boxes, labeling packages, inspecting products for quality, and ensuring items are securely packed to prevent damage during transportation. They often work in warehouses, manufacturing plants, or distribution centers and may use various tools and machines to assist with packaging. Attention to detail and the ability to work efficiently are important skills for this role.

What do packing associates do?

Packing associates are responsible for preparing products for shipment by packing, labeling, and organizing items efficiently and accurately. They often operate packing equipment, follow safety procedures, and ensure that packages meet quality standards in a warehouse or distribution center environment.

What is the difference between Packaging Associate vs Material Handler?

AspectPackaging AssociateMaterial Handler
Primary RoleAssembles, packages, and prepares products for shipmentMoves, loads, and unloads materials within a facility
Skills & CertificationsBasic math, attention to detail, possibly forklift certificationForklift operation, inventory management, safety training
Work EnvironmentWarehouse, production lines, packaging stationsWarehouse, distribution centers, manufacturing plants
Industry UsageManufacturing, logistics, retailManufacturing, warehousing, distribution

While both roles operate within warehouse and manufacturing settings, Packaging Associates focus on preparing products for shipment by packaging and labeling, whereas Material Handlers manage the movement and storage of materials. Both roles require safety awareness and may involve forklift operation, but their core responsibilities differ significantly.

Alliance Packaging - Family Owned, Family Operated, Since 1967

Alliance Packaging is Northwest's largest independent corrugated box manufacturer with a well-deserved reputation for producing the very best in packaging products on our state-of-the-art converting equipment. Alliance Packaging is an equal opportunity, harassment-free and drug-free company.

We are currently looking to add to our manufacturing personnel on the Day Shift and Swing Shift crews at our Hillsboro facility. Looking for motivated individuals to join us and grow with our team! Some of the attributes we are looking for in a potential team member include having a high focus on the safety of self and others, being attentive to details and quality in your work, working with a high sense of urgency, proven reliability in regards to punctuality/attendance, and above all- having a positive attitude with an eagerness to learn, grow, and contribute to the team.

As a Manufacturing Associate you will be given the opportunity to learn from some of our very best manufacturing personnel. As new skills are acquired and position steps are reached, your achievements will be compensated monetarily.

Benefits

  • Health, Dental
  • Paid Vacation
  • Paid Sick Leave
  • Paid Holiday
  • 401(k) plan
  • Annual reviews and wage increases based on performance and skill progression.

Responsibilities

  • Learn to safely and efficiently operate various pieces of converting equipment
  • Effectively learn and apply established quality control procedure
  • Effectively execute position responsibilities as they pertain to the assigned work center.
  • Read and follow order specification documents
  • Consistently work to develop or enhance skill set.
  • Effectively work with co-workers and establish a team approach to achieve company goals and expectations.
  • Follow all company rules and policies.
  • Successfully work in multiple areas of the converting plant and be able to perform to expectations.

Basic Qualifications to succeed

  • Mechanically inclined and able to learn new skills within a standard timeline.
  • Comfortable around heavy equipment in a fast pace environment.
  • Mentally and physically perform at a high pace with a sense of urgency while maintaining company expectation of Safety, Quality, and Productivity.
  • Basic Math Knowledge and ability to read a tape measure.
  • Possess a strong attention to detail
  • Ability to work overtime

Requirements

  • Must be at least 18+ years old
  • Must be able to lift 50 lbs.
  • Must be authorized to work in the U.S.
  • Must pass drug screen, and physical abilities test.
